Types of Tailoring & Maggam Techniques We Teach

Our training program covers a complete range of tailoring and Maggam embroidery techniques for traditional and contemporary fashion. Whether you're interested in basic stitching or advanced Maggam artistry, we provide comprehensive skill development.

We train students in basic to advanced tailoring (blouses, dresses, suits, ethnic wear), Maggam embroidery (traditional South Indian designs), zardozi work, sequin and bead embroidery, appliqué work, patchwork, fabric manipulation techniques, pattern making and drafting, fitting and alterations, and machine and hand embroidery techniques.

From simple stitching to intricate Maggam patterns, our curriculum prepares you to create professional-grade garments and embroidery work for both personal and commercial purposes.

Traditional & Modern Equipment Training

We provide training with both traditional hand tools and modern equipment including sewing machines (manual, electric, computerized), Maggam frames and hooks, embroidery machines, cutting tools, measuring instruments, and specialized Maggam needles and threads for different fabric types.
